What is the Goethe Certificate?
The Goethe Certificate, also referred to as the Goethe-Institut Prüfungen, is a series of standardized exams developed to examine and certify the German language efficiency of candidates. The Goethe-Institut, a prominent cultural organization based in Germany, administers these tests internationally. The Goethe Certificate is especially valued by companies, educational institutions, and immigration authorities as proof of language knowledge.

Levels of the Goethe Certificate
The Goethe Certificate is structured according to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) and is divided into six proficiency levels varying from A1 (newbie) to C2 (proficient). Each level involves a various degree of linguistic capability:
A1: Beginner-- Ability to comprehend and use basic expressions and expressions.A2: Elementary-- Understanding sentences and regularly used expressions associated to individual and daily subjects.B1: Intermediate-- Ability to produce easy text on topics of individual interest and converse on familiar subjects.B2: Upper Intermediate-- Competence to comprehend the essences in intricate texts and to interact with a degree of fluency.C1: Advanced-- Proficiency in comprehending a vast array of requiring texts and expressing concepts with complete confidence.C2: Proficient-- Mastery of the language, including the ability to understand virtually whatever read and heard.Structure of the Goethe Certificate Exams
Each level of the Goethe Certificate consists of four elements: reading, writing, listening, and speaking. The exams also examine interactive language skills in real-life contexts. Here's a quick overview of each part:

Reading: Candidates read different texts (posts, advertisements, literature) and respond to comprehension questions to assess their understanding.

Composing: This section involves composing brief essays or letters. Candidates need to demonstrate clarity, coherence, and appropriate use of grammatical structures.

Listening: This part examines the candidate's listening skills through audio recordings, consisting of conversations, statements, and interviews. Prospects must answer questions based upon what they hear.

Speaking: The speaking exam normally involves an in person interaction with an examiner. Prospects engage in dialogues, react to questions, and perhaps offer a short discussion.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Is the Goethe Certificate legitimate worldwide?
Yes, the Goethe Certificate is recognized internationally, making it a reliable proof of German efficiency for academic and professional functions.
2. The length of time is the Goethe Certificate valid?
The Goethe Certificate does not have a strict expiration date. Nevertheless, language skills can lessen over time, so it is suggested to take refresher courses if considerable time has actually passed.
3. Can I retake the exam if I do not pass?
Yes, candidates can retake the exam as lot of times as they want. It is advised to focus on the areas where improvement is needed before trying again.
4. How do I register for the Goethe Certificate exam?
Candidates can sign up online through the Goethe-Institut's main site or straight at their regional Goethe-Institut center.
